Vibrio vulnificus, the most fatal waterborne and foodborne pathogens of 50% fatality rate in the world, is common in seawater and occurs particularly in warmer months. In this study, we investigated the toxin genes using reverse transcription-polymerase chain reaction (RT-PCR), antibiotic resistance...
